On Thu, Oct 23, 2008, Rev Simon Rumble wrote:
> You might want to look into the Crawl-delay extension to the robots.txt
> standard, which can limit by robot:
> http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Robots.txt#Crawl-delay_directive
There's also the Sitemaps protocol, in which you can suggest how
frequently content changes: http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Sitemaps
It doesn't seem to come with any guarentees that the robots will respect
that as a refresh frequency though.
